Exploring of Okinawa, Japan: An Overview

Okinawa is a beautiful island located in the southernmost part of Japan. Known for its stunning beaches, vibrant marine life, and rich cultural history, Okinawa offers a unique blend of leisure, cultural exposure, and educational opportunities. The island is also famous for its traditional Okinawan cuisine and friendly locals who make every visit memorable.

Okinawa has a rich history that dates back to the Ryukyu Kingdom. It played a significant role during World War II.

The island boasts a unique culture influenced by its Ryukyu heritage. The local economy is driven by tourism, agriculture, and fishing.

What Is the Weather Like in Okinawa, Japan During August?

August weather in Okinawa is typically hot and humid, with temperatures ranging from 28°C to 32°C. Though it's the end of the rainy season, occasional showers may occur. The warm sea temperature makes it perfect for water activities.

What Is the best Season for Visiting Okinawa, Japan?

The optimal time to visit Okinawa is between April and October when the weather is warm and conducive for beach activities. However, to avoid typhoon season, late April to early June and late September to October are ideal.

Connectivity Info

Naha Airport is well-connected with major cities in Japan and some international locations.

Frequent buses and monorails connect the airport to various parts of the island.

Car rentals are available for those who prefer to drive.

Taxis are plentiful and can be hailed easily around tourist areas.

Local ferries connect the main island with smaller surrounding islands.

Accept Currency + Payment Type

The local currency is Japanese Yen (JPY).

Credit cards are accepted in major hotels and restaurants but not everywhere.

It's advisable to carry cash for small purchases and at local markets.

ATMs are available widely, especially at convenience stores.
